Save

User gayizink uploaded this Nintendo - Toki Tori 2 Nintendo Switch RIVE Two Tribes Publishing B.V. PNG PNG image on March 9, 2025, 2:55 pm. The resolution of this file is 1024x1024px and its file size is: 152.01 KB. This PNG image is filed under the tags: